LEAD, S.D. (AP) - The city of Lead has established a parks improvement reserve fund.
The Black Hills Pioneer reports (https://bit.ly/1A2OMga) that the fund was sparked by plans to replace the restroom facility at the city’s Manuel Brothers Park.
City officials approved a plan to move $59,000 from the general fund to the new reserve, and put all $10,000 from the city’s bridge fund into the account.
There are no longer any bridges left within city limits.
